Application
- Chromatographic behaviour of ionic liquid cations in view of quantitative structure-retention relationship.: This study explores the chromatographic behavior of ionic liquid cations using quantitative structure-retention relationships (QSRR). The SUPELCOSIL™ LC-8 HPLC Column was utilized to analyze retention data for various ionic liquids, providing insights into their separation mechanisms and potential applications in analytical chemistry (Molíková et al., 2010).
- Liquid chromatographic method for the determination of lidocaine and monoethylglycine xylidide in human serum containing various concentrations of bilirubin for the assessment of liver function.: The research presents a liquid chromatographic method using the SUPELCOSIL™ LC-8 HPLC Column to determine lidocaine and its metabolite in human serum. This method is particularly useful for assessing liver function by measuring drug metabolism (Piwowarska et al., 2004).
- LC determination of morphine and morphine glucuronides in human plasma by coulometric and UV detection.: The research describes a method for the determination of morphine and its glucuronides in human plasma. Utilizing the SUPELCOSIL™ LC-8 HPLC Column, the study demonstrates the method′s sensitivity and applicability in pharmaceutical analysis (Ary et al., 2001).
